I'm sure the Viper was a
standard non-RS Camaro and I know it was red originally. It had the 200kmph
speedo, but since the car has been heavily modified there is no more tell
tale signs to look for as for it being a Yutivo, we will have to ask John
and rely on his memory. I know he got it out of a junk yard in Angeles City
originally. The cool pictures of the
car in front of the Blue Nile and Neros in Angeles City was taken in 2002.
The bar wanted some promotional pictures of car and driver after I set a V-8
record and was the first V-8 to break into the 10's in the Philippines. The
old 10 sec pass was with the 350 on nitrous at a PDRF event at Harbor Center
in Manila The car get a lot of attention because of its history as being from the Philippines and that it has been raced in the Phillipines as well. I first started racing the car in 2000 and raced it until 2004, then I shipped it to the U.S. Back in those days I raced it with a 350 smallblock, now of course it has been swapped with a 440cui smallblock, see specs below..
